Democrats lead in Kentucky by 3 points in latest PPP (D)PPP (D) poll
On April 11, PPP (D)PPP (D) released the results of a new poll, in which respondents from Kentucky were asked for whom they would vote if the parties' nominees were Hillary Clinton for the Democrats and Donald Trump for the Republicans.
The results reveal that 45.0% of respondents plan to vote for the Democrat Hillary Clinton, whereas 42.0% said they would vote for the Republican Donald Trump. The poll was conducted from June 18 to June 21 among 1108 registered voters. Translating these results into two-party vote shares yields values of 51.7% for the Democrats and 48.3% for the Republicans.
